Output e91c2bc30451000dd410cf58ac6eec6ab61b850ee0a5540e7decb93fad8be2ea:3

value
74579820
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21651c37d4f743aa56f52b92e8897b81cfa5ebdb OP_EQUALVERIFY OP_CHECKSIG
address
143aRbLw2oVriLP4cjWhadaQL957ZXs1HN
transaction
e91c2bc30451000dd410cf58ac6eec6ab61b850ee0a5540e7decb93fad8be2ea
spent
true